About the Role

Total Wine & More is seeking a Data Scientist, Operations Research to join our Data Services team in Bethesda, MD. In this role, you will develop and implement optimization and decision-science solutions that support business decisions across areas such as pricing, inventory, supply chain, and marketing.

You will translate defined business problems into mathematical models, evaluate potential solutions, and help integrate model outputs into business processes and production workflows. This role requires foundational experience in operations research, data analysis, and software development, along with the ability to work independently on routine to moderately complex assignments. You will collaborate with more experienced team members and business partners when addressing unfamiliar or challenging problems. This role reports to the Senior Director, Data Science.

You will
  • Develop mathematical optimization models, including linear programming (LP), mixed-integer linear programming (MILP), and related techniques, based on defined business objectives and constraints.
  • Design and implement optimization solutions using Gurobi or comparable solver technologies.
  • Assess business requirements, available data, and operational constraints to determine appropriate modeling approaches.
  • Evaluate model results through scenario testing, sensitivity analysis, and validation to confirm that solutions meet defined business needs.
  • Implement optimization outputs within established production workflows and business processes.
  • Develop and maintain data pipelines that support modeling workflows and promote data quality, availability, and reliability.
  • Resolve routine modeling, data, and performance issues, escalating more complex challenges when appropriate.
  • Develop scalable and maintainable code using Python and SQL in accordance with established development standards.
  • Facilitate discussions with business partners and cross-functional team members to clarify objectives, constraints, assumptions, and expected outcomes.
  • Communicate modeling approaches, assumptions, results, and recommendations in a clear and practical manner.
  • Monitor model performance and recommend adjustments based on business needs, data changes, and solution results.
  • Contribute to team knowledge by sharing technical approaches and providing guidance to less-experienced colleagues when appropriate.
You will come with
  • Bachelor's degree in Operations Research, Industrial Engineering, Applied Mathematics, Computer Science, Data Science,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• A master's degree in a related field is preferred.
  • 1-4 years of relevant experience in Operations Research / Optimization or related fields preferred
  • Hands‑on experience with Gurobi (strongly preferred) or similar solvers (CPLEX, OR-Tools, etc.)
  • Proven experience building and deploying large-scale mathematical models (LP, MILP, etc.) in production environments
  • Ability to design and maintain data pipelines for large-scale modeling workflows and experience working with large, complex datasets, including feature engineering and data validation
  • Proficiency in Python and SQL, with emphasis on scalable, maintainable code
  • Familiarity with cloud environments (AWS, Azure, GCP) for scalable execution
